Built in 1916, the Lide House is a 3 bedroom 3 bath arts & crafts style home in the Washington Street Historic District is within walking distance to downtown Camden, Arkansas.
Even before you’re inside, you will see why this house is so charming. The L-shaped front porch features stone beams and provides plenty of seating areas to enjoy cool breezes. Once inside, you’ll see a large front room with built-in cabinets, reading bench/window seat with storage underneath, original hardwood floors, a gas-log fireplace, and 10′ ceilings.
Glass pocket doors lead to the dining room with refinished built-in cabinets. The library/office features a custom-built desk with corner shelves, Saltillo tile, and original built-in cabinets.
The family room features more tile and a gorgeous built-in bookcase that flanks a wood-burning fireplace. The ceiling in this room has been restored to the natural roofline from an existing add-on, and the recessed LED can lighting and ceiling fan with light give you options for the room’s use. Pella doors with attached screens and embedded blinds slide back to allow you to access the deck and fenced backyard.
In the newly remodeled and updated kitchen, you’ll find a breakfast nook, custom coffee/wine bar, cabinets, wine glass racks, and an island with a prep sink. Also included is a large AGA Legacy dual-fuel range featuring two ovens and a built-in side-by-side refrigerator/freezer.
The two main bedrooms feature hardwood floors, large closets, and their own full baths.
The master bathroom features new carpet and a large bathroom with a claw foot tub.

Other details: Situated on a large double lot, .86 acres, the property features a stained back deck in the back with plenty of built-in storage boxes and storage beneath. The front lawn features raised garden beds and stately crape myrtles. Other outside updates include a new outbuilding/workshop with a covered carport with electric. The flowerbeds are in constant bloom with hydrangeas, lilies, hostas, and other plants. The backlot beyond the gates of the privacy fence features a wide array of ferns and blooming plants including irises, roses, and daffodils.
